BREAKFAST GRANOLA

  • 2 cups Oats, old fashioned
  • 1 cup Almonds, sliced
  • 1/3 cup Frozen apple juice, thawed
  • 2 tablespoons Brown sugar, firmly packed
  • 1 tablespoon Cinnamon
  • 1 cup Coconut, shredded
  • 1/3 cup Cherries, dehydrated and cut up
  • OR
  • 1/2 cup Raisins, golden
  • Preheat oven to 300° Combine oats and almonds in bowl. Mix in juice concentrate. Add sugar and cinnamon and toss together. Spread out on cookie sheet. Bake for 15-25 minutes, stirring until golden browned. Remove from oven and cool. Add cherries or raisins to granola. Store in air tight container at room temperature

    For large recipe, quadruple. This uses the whole 12 oz. concentrate of apple juice, 8 cups of oats, 8 Tablespoons of brown sugar, 4 Tbsp. of cinnamon, and 3-4 cups of shredded coconut.
